Output 70b6a54b42bd39d7af6dd95546d8b5c1d02b03e6e09bfcf6e4e3a515b7924b8e:1

value
143800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ba6e8b27cc6899253ffd3d7bf907d77d66cfce8 OP_EQUALVERIFY OP_CHECKSIG
address
124cP9dyiTKGmjRG2VL6VqvCQhoVtgpEDL
transaction
70b6a54b42bd39d7af6dd95546d8b5c1d02b03e6e09bfcf6e4e3a515b7924b8e
confirmations
486785
spent
true